| Nathaniel Hawthorne was one of the most influential Romantic novelists in the first-half of the 19th Century. His thought is extremely serious and profound. His thought is represented in the great concern of human heart, which makes up fundamental themes in his novels. This thesis is focused on the combination of family background and the cultural atmosphere and the era in which he lived.
